System.currentTimeMillis();
用这个函数可以得到当前的时间,精确到毫秒级
end_time-start_time就可以实现计时的功能但是好像没法实时显示阿大家有没有好的方法

解决方案 »

  1.   


    比如说计时显示: 00:00:45.345
    每过一毫秒,实时显示变化
    Chronometer调用一个成员方法函数就可以实现了,只是精确到秒
    也就是00:00:45
    那毫秒呢?
      

  2.   

    试试用Timer做实时更新了 好像记得它是支持毫秒级的
      

  3.   

    学习一下,之前用过System.currentTimeMillis();这个方法,如果想要实时显示,可以编写一个handler,对计时器的进程实时获取时间,然后再写activity调用输出,我只能这么做,哪位有更简单的,分享一下啊。
      

  4.   

    在印象中那个Timer是支持毫秒的吧?